DGRO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2025 in Review

1,120 of the 7,458 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in iShares Core Dividend Growth ETF (DGRO) for Q1 2025, worth a combined $18.8B — up 5.2% from $17.8B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 81 funds opened new DGRO positions and 60 closed out — a net gain of 21 holders — while 475 added to existing stakes and 390 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Jones Financial Companies, adding an estimated $101M. The largest seller was Envestnet Asset Management, cutting an estimated $72.3M.
